The Pirates! In An Adventure With Scientists Exhibition Opens In Birmingham Today




Visitors to Thinktank, Birmingham’s science museum, will experience a swashbuckling adventure this summer when they get the chance to immerse themselves in the world created in Sony Pictures Animation and Aardman Animations’ Academy Award-nominated blockbuster, The Pirates! In an Adventure with Scientists! David Tennant voices the character of Darwin in the film.
The touring exhibition brings together for the first time in public the exquisitely crafted sets and puppets from the film and encourages visitors to become part of The Pirate Captain’s crew. From dressing up in pirate finery to steering a galleon and playing a part in the movie using clever blue-screen technology, there is a wealth of activities to enchant all audiences.
In a reference to the film’s ‘Polly’ –  the dodo that thinks it’s a parrot - visitors will also have the chance to see the renowned ‘Oxford Dodo’. Oxford University Museum of Natural Historywill be lending its reconstruction of the the famously extinct bird to Thinktank for the duration of the exhibition, which links the animation and creativity of the film with the world of Natural History.
Janine Eason, Director of Learning and Exhibitions at Thinktank said: “It’s been very exciting to see this exhibition develop and we look forward to welcoming visitors into the Pirates’ world. Working with Aardman Animations on the project is fantastic; the painstaking detail and craftsmanship in the sets alone is breathtaking. When you couple that with the imagination-capturing and interactive elements Thintank’s exhibition will offer, it’s a summer show not to be missed”.
Peter Lord, Co-founder and Creative Director of Aardman Animations said:“I'm so happy that our Pirates exhibition is coming to Birmingham. It shows off all the things that I'm most proud of – the care, the artistry and the genius that goes into making of one of our films. People will have a chance to get up close to some of the fantastic models and sets that we made. We've got Charles Darwin's cabin, part of Blood Island, a huge pile of pirate treasure - and of course the magnificent Pirate Ship in all it's glory. Have a look at it. Some rather dodgy Pirates must have done a 'cut and shut' job on her because the bow end and the stern end don't match at all. And the figure-head clearly lost her head a long time ago. There's so much detail and comedy in all these sets. 
“And then of course we will take the visitors behind the scenes to catch a glimpse of all the crafts involved in filmmaking – everything from design to model making to animation. So as well as being a visual delight, I also hope the exhibition will inspire young animators to have a go themselves.”
The Pirates! In an Adventure with Scientists The Exhibition opens to the public at Thinktank on May 23rd and will run until September. Entry to the exhibition will be included in the Thinktank ticket price and a programme of accompanying events and activities will be made available nearer the date of the exhibition. The Pirates! Scoops RTS West Award For Best Film



The Pirates! In An Adventure With Scientists picked up the Best Film award at the West of England RTS Awards this evening. The animated feature from Bristol based Aardman Animations features the vocal talents of Hugh Grant, David Tennant, Imelda Staunton, Brian Blessed and Martin Freeman among a star-studded cast list.

It was a good night overall for Aardman as they also picked up the Media Effectiveness award for their Nike 'Take Control' advert while Gavin Strange, senior designer for Aardman (@JamFactory on Twitter), celebrated being part of the team that created online games for the CBBC series Andy's Wild Adventures, winner of the Best Companion Content award

The West of England RTS Awards were presented at a ceremony held at the Bristol Old Vic.

Aardman will be waiting anxiously for news from Hollywood tonight as The Pirates! is also nominated for an Oscar in the Animated Feature Film category.

EDIT: Sadly The Pirates! lost out to Pixar's Brave for the Animated Feature Film Oscar

Australian DVD And Blu-ray Release For The Pirates! Band Of Misfits



The fantastic 2012 Aardman animated movie The Pirates! band Of Misfits (known also as The Pirates! In An Adventure With Scientists) is released on DVD and Blu-ray in Australia today.


In The Pirates! In an Adventure with Scientists 3D, Hugh Grant stars in his first animated role as the luxuriantly bearded Pirate Captain – a boundlessly enthusiastic, if somewhat less-than-successful, terror of the High Seas.
With a rag-tag crew at his side (Martin Freeman, Brendan Gleeson, Russell Tovey, and Ashley Jensen), and seemingly blind to the impossible odds stacked against him, the Captain has one dream: to beat his bitter rivals Black Bellamy (Jeremy Piven) and Cutlass Liz (Salma Hayek) to the much coveted Pirate Of The Year Award. It’s a quest that takes our heroes from the shores of exotic Blood Island to the foggy streets of Victorian London.
Along the way they battle a diabolical queen (Imelda Staunton) and team up with a haplessly smitten young scientist (David Tennant), but never lose sight of what a pirate loves best: adventure!

The film was adapted from the novel by Gideon Defoe and directed for Aardman and Sony Pictures by Peter Lord. It is available in four formats: DVD, standard Blu-ray, 3D Blu-ray and triple play DVD, Blu-ray and digital pack. It is available now from all major retailers.

David Talks To Digital Spy About The Pirates!


David took part in a number of interviews last week to promote his brilliant new movie, The Pirates! In An Adventure With Scientists!, which is released on 28th March 2012 in the UK.
The latest interview to be released is one that he did with Digital Spy.
Speaking to Digital Spy, David admitted to them that it was an easy decision to sign up for the animated movie:
"I remember thinking, 'This script is going to have to be really bad for me not to do this'," he said. "You just want to be associated with what Aardman do. It's never less than excellent. When I did read the script I thought, 'This is just a joy!'"
And asked if he thought he would make a good pirate he replied: "I'm probably more of a natural fit for the Charlie Darwin type. I imagine I'd be a rubbish pirate, but then they're pretty rubbish pirates so I could work that out."
